Output 312ea63b51757149dc243bce9c0c7fcb89a9c4c0c05d01f61a897a3a8c30341e:24

value
2957933
script pubkey
OP_0 OP_PUSHBYTES_20 9f8f0d1eea150d64c6724e6eeb9fb49e370a74ad
address
bc1qn78s68h2z5xkf3njfehwh8a5ncms5a9dkyaz9k
transaction
312ea63b51757149dc243bce9c0c7fcb89a9c4c0c05d01f61a897a3a8c30341e
spent
true